    Abstract: An optical head includes a first module that concentrates pump light and Stokes light on a first point; a second module that collects CARS light from the first point; and a third module that supports the first module and the second module. The first module includes: a high rigidity first frame; and a first optical system including a plurality of optical elements fixed to the first frame. The second module includes: a high rigidity second frame; and a second optical system including a plurality of optical elements fixed to the second frame. The third module includes a high rigidity third frame that fixes the first frame and the second frame.

    Abstract: A housing for accommodating a radiation detecting member, has a first plate member to which radiation is incident from an outside of the housing; a second plate member arranged opposite to the first plate member; a radiation detecting member provided between the first plate member and the second plate member and having a radiation receiving surface to detect the radiation having passed through the first plate member; and a scattering radiation shielding member arranged at a radiation receiving surface side of the radiation detecting member and to eliminate scattering radiation from the radiation before the radiation is detected by the radiation receiving surface.

    Abstract: A medical image processing system having: an input section for inputting image information of a patient; an output section for visualizing the image information of a patient inputted from the input section; and an image-attached information recording section; wherein, the image-attached information recording section records, as information attached to image information, at least one of information of the input section which has been used for inputting the image information, and information of the cassette which has been loaded in the input section and used for inputting the image information or on the stimulable phosphor sheet loaded in the cassette.

    Abstract: An apparatus for reading a radiographic image is provided with a holding section for holding a medium taken out from a cassette, wherein the medium has a recording surface on which the radiographic image is stored, the hold section holding the medium such that the orientation of the recording surface is substantially vertical; and a reading section for reading the radiographic image on the recording surface of the medium held by the holding section, thereby obtaining radiographic image information from the recording surface.

    Abstract: Image information recorded on a sheet-shaped recording medium is read and converted into digital image data, wherein the image information includes medical image information and image information used for orientation discrimination and the image information for orientation discrimination is recorded at a predetermined position on the sheet-shaped recording medium. The position of the image information for orientation discrimination on the sheet-shaped arrangement of digital image data corresponding to the sheet-shaped recording medium is recognized. Then, the mounted orientation of the sheet-shaped recording medium is discriminated on the basis of the recognized position of the image information for orientation discrimination on the sheet-shaped data arrangement of digital image data.

    Abstract: An image reading apparatus which includes a primary scanner for scanning an original X-ray image obtained using a grid and recorded on a recording medium with light in a primary scanning direction. A clock signal generator generates clock signals having a frequency N times as high as a frequency of pixel clock signals, wherein the pixel clock signals correspond to a desired pixel size, and wherein N is a positive integer. A converter converts a light beam from the recording medium into electric signals by a scanning operation of the primary scanner, and converts the electric signals into digital signals based on the clock signals. A low pass filter is provided which has at least one set of filter characteristics having a cut-off frequency between 1/3 and 2/3 of the frequency of the pixel clock signals for filtering the digital signals converted by the converter.

    Abstract: An image reading apparatus that illuminates or irradiates a document by scanning for reading in two orthogonal directions. In a mode preceding a reading mode, it photoelectrically converts transmitted or reflected light into an image signal, employs a stored threshold value for comparison with the image signal, and discriminates document position or size based on the comparison to set a reading area for the document, such as a medical X-ray film. A reading control inhibits the reading mode while the document is irradiated in the sub-scanning direction from its tip edge across a predetermined distance. The discrimination of a possibly faulty position, including some inclination error, of the X-ray film and the setting of the reading area compensates for the faulty position before the subsequent reading mode begins. The setting of the reading area can involve some re-conveying of the document. An alarm is generated if the discrimination determines that an appropriate reading area cannot be set.

    Abstract: An image data compression apparatus, in that a component characteristic value of an AC component in a block obtained by dividing digital tonal image data is compared with a predetermined threshold value so that a frequency of an AC component at the highest frequency side having the component characteristic value over the threshold value is determined as a boundary value, and in that the AC component exceeding the boundary value is not handled as a substantial transform coefficient. When the transform coefficients in a high-frequency side in the block is cut according to an image content of the block a lower limit of a frequency to be cut is determined, so that a frequency lower than the lower limit determined may not be cut.
